How the city shapes plans
Hills, harbour footpaths, and uneven nightlife clusters mean a “quick pint in town” can become a trek. Pick first meets near a stop or car park both of you can explain to a friend. Harbourside is public and busy at the right hours. Side streets empty earlier than visitors expect. Choose light and footfall for meet one.
Bath is close and still a separate plan. If you live between the two, say which city you can do on a weeknight. If you will not travel to Bath at all, say that before someone assumes a romantic day trip you cannot book around childcare.
Weather changes outdoor plans fast. Always name an indoor backup. Adults with children already live in Plan B. Dating should too.
Profiles that read as local and honest
Use recent photos in ordinary light. Show your face clearly. Keep children’s faces off the profile. Mention children in words if they exist in your life. If they do not, say whether dating a parent is welcome. Add work pattern if shifts rule your week.
One true Bristol detail beats a moodboard: a market you use, a park that fits a buggy, a gallery you return to, a Sunday cook you actually make. Avoid competitor talk and invented popularity. Avoid phrases that promise endless freedom you do not have.
Write intent in plain English. “I want a partner who can handle real weeks and still enjoy a good conversation” is stronger than a stack of buzzwords.
Messages that survive school terms
Open with a specific note from their profile, then ask one real question. Share your answer too. Propose two meeting windows within a few days of mutual interest. If bedtime is sacred, protect it out loud. People who respect that are better matches than people who negotiate it away.
Talk about children at summary level early. Keep school names, addresses, and identifying routines for later. If someone asks for photos of your children, refuse. That request is not romantic. It is a privacy failure.
Sexual intensity on day one is a common filter. Many Bristol adults, especially parents, will leave. Warmth is welcome. Pressure is not.
First meets
Daytime coffee, an early meal, or a short visit to a busy public attraction works well. Arrive independently. Set an end time. Keep alcohol light or skip it. Do not go to a private home. Do not bring children to a first romantic meet.
If a plan collides with a handover, reschedule early. A person who punishes you for parenting logistics is incompatible, no matter how good the chat felt at midnight.
Choose venues where leaving is simple. You should never need permission to end a meet that feels wrong.

Safety
Tell a friend. Meet in public. Keep your own way home. Ignore money stories. Leave if details do not match. Report tools are there for harassment and scams. Emergency services are there for danger. Caution is not coldness. In Bristol dating, caution is how adults stay available for the right person.
Creative work, gig economy hours, and dating energy
Bristol’s creative reputation includes irregular hours. Freelancers, hospitality workers, and carers often have calendars that do not match office dating advice. If your busy season is Christmas retail or summer festivals, say when you disappear and when you return. Adults can plan around seasons. They resent unexplained silence.
Energy matters after parenting all day. A first meet should not require peak performance. Coffee can reveal more than a loud night out. If you want a walk, keep it short and public. If you want food, choose somewhere you can end cleanly.
Money talk belongs early enough to prevent fantasy. You do not need a spreadsheet on message three. You do need honesty about whether expensive habits are realistic while raising children or paying rent in a costly city.
Shared values beyond the harbour photo
Ask about kindness under stress, views on blending households later, and how conflict gets handled. Bristol lifestyles vary widely. Compatibility is not guaranteed by living in the same postcode cluster. Two people can love the harbourside and still want different lives on Sunday morning.
When a chat is good but logistics never land, believe the logistics. Dating is a behaviour pattern. In Bristol, as elsewhere, patterns show up quickly if you watch for them.
Parents, non-parents, and saying the quiet parts
If you are a single parent in Bristol, say what support you have and what you do not. You do not owe a full household inventory. You do owe enough clarity that someone can decide whether your week fits theirs. If you have no children, say whether you want them in your future, whether you can date a parent whose children are young, and whether overnight stays are a long way off.
Jealousy of time spent with children sinks otherwise decent matches. Watch for it. A partner who competes with a child is not a partner to keep. A parent who uses children as a shield against intimacy is also a hard fit. Name needs without using kids as weapons.
Good Bristol dating looks like two adults designing a small plan and keeping it. It looks like honesty when energy is low. It looks like ending kindly when the fit is wrong so both people can meet someone better matched.
